Victor Abondo quits Gor Mahia amid interest from South African club


Midfileder Victor Abondo, also known as ‘Teargas’ has left premier league defending champions Gor Mahia.

This development was confirmed by coach Frank Nuttal on Sunday, in his pre-match interview in the crunch derby against AFC Leopards at the Safaricom Stadium, Kasarani.

He said: “We have lost 60 percent of our goals from last season. Olunga(Micheal), Kagere (Meddie) are not with us and now, Abondo was released by the club on Friday. I now have to work out new combinations to make is start scoring again,” said Nuttal.

Abondo is has set his sights to joining South African club Ajax Cape Town.

The 26 year-old was on trial with the PSL club for the better part of last month and was later reported to have impressed his prospective employers.

Abondo is both a versatile and experienced midfielder in the Kenya Premier League as well as a Kenyan international, having enjoyed spells at Sony Sugar, Tusker and Gor Mahia over the past half a decade.

He had his best spell under Nuttal at Gor Mahia last term, scoring 12 goals in total.
